Especially with Jeep and other US vehicles, the technical model year often differs from the year of first registration. The most reliable reference is therefore the standardized 17-character Vehicle Identification Number, also known as the VIN or chassis number.
On this page, we explain how to read your Jeep VIN, how to determine the correct Jeep model year from 2011 to 2018, and which VIN details are especially important for the Jeep Wrangler JK, Jeep Wrangler JK Unlimited and Jeep Grand Cherokee WK2.
The VIN can help identify the model year, vehicle line, engine code, body style, drive type, trim level and assembly plant. These details are often more important for Jeep part fitment than the general model name alone.
Quick Tip: Identify the Model Year by the 10th VIN Character
The 10th character of the Jeep VIN identifies the technical model year. For the model years covered in this guide, the following codes apply:
- B = 2011
- C = 2012
- D = 2013
- E = 2014
- F = 2015
- G = 2016
- H = 2017
- J = 2018
Important: The letter I is not used as a model-year code in the VIN. Therefore, H = 2017 is followed by J = 2018.
Jeep VIN 2011–2018: Quick Overview of the Most Important Positions
The 17-character Jeep VIN contains several details that are important for vehicle identification and part fitment. For model years 2011 to 2018, the following VIN positions are especially relevant:
| VIN position | Meaning | Why it matters |
|---|---|---|
| 5 | Vehicle line / drive type / configuration | Helps distinguish Wrangler JK, Wrangler JK Unlimited, Grand Cherokee WK2, left-hand drive, right-hand drive, 2WD and 4WD versions. |
| 6 | Series, trim level or transmission | May identify Sport, Sahara, Rubicon, Laredo, Limited, Overland, SRT8 or transmission variants. |
| 7 | Body style / model-year range / configuration | Important for 2-door, 4-door, JK 72, JK 74 and, on Grand Cherokee models, sometimes LHD/RHD versions. |
| 8 | Engine code | Important for engine parts, sensors, cooling system, exhaust components, filters, gaskets and electronics. |
| 10 | Model year | Often more important for spare parts than the first registration date, especially around model changes. |
| 11 | Assembly plant | Can be relevant for production- or market-specific differences. |

Why the 7th VIN Character Matters on Jeep Vehicles
In addition to the 10th character, the 7th VIN character helps identify the correct model-year range. This is useful because model-year codes can be reused after longer periods.
| 7th VIN character | Jeep model-year range |
|---|---|
| Number, e.g. 1–9 | Model years 1980 to 2009 |
| Letter, e.g. A–Z | Model years 2010 to 2039 |
Where Can I Find the VIN on My Jeep?
The 17-character Jeep VIN / Vehicle Identification Number can usually be found in the following places:
- Vehicle registration documents: The VIN is listed in your official vehicle papers or title documents.
- Windshield: Usually visible from the outside at the lower driver-side corner of the windshield.
- Vehicle identification plates: Depending on the model, the VIN may also appear on manufacturer or type identification plates on the vehicle.

Especially Important: Model Changes and Technical Differences
The period from 2011 to 2018 is highly relevant for Jeep spare parts. On the Wrangler JK, there are important differences between earlier model years with the 3.8 L V6 and later model years with the 3.6 L V6. On the Grand Cherokee WK2, engine, trim level, LHD/RHD configuration and model year are also essential for correct part selection.
For this reason, the VIN should always be checked before ordering vehicle-specific Jeep spare parts.

VIN Codes Jeep Wrangler JK & JK Unlimited: Model Years 2011–2018
The following tables help decode the VIN for the Jeep Wrangler JK and Jeep Wrangler JK Unlimited for model years 2011 to 2018.
VIN Positions 1 to 4: Country, Manufacturer, Vehicle Type and GVWR
| VIN position | Meaning | Code | Explanation |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Country | 1 | USA |
| 2 | Manufacturer | J | Jeep |
| 2 | Manufacturer | C | Chrysler Group LLC |
| 3 | Vehicle type | 4 | MPV without side airbags |
| 3 | Vehicle type | 8 | MPV with side airbags |
| 4 | GVWR | A / G / N / V | 1815–2267 kg / 4001–5000 lb |
| 4 | GVWR | B / H / P / X | 2268–2721 kg / 5001–6000 lb |
| 4 | GVWR | C / J / R / Y | 2722–3175 kg / 6001–7000 lb |
| 4 | GVWR | D / K / S / Z | 3176–3628 kg / 7001–8000 lb |
| 4 | GVWR | E / L / T / 1 | 3629–4082 kg / 8001–9000 lb |
VIN Position 5: Vehicle Line / Drive Configuration on Wrangler JK
| Code | Meaning |
|---|---|
| B | Wrangler left-hand drive 4x2 |
| A | Wrangler left-hand drive 4x4 |
| E | Wrangler right-hand drive 4x4, BUX |
| J | Wrangler left-hand drive 4x4 |
| Z | Wrangler right-hand drive 4x4, U.S. / Canada |
VIN Position 6: Series / Trim / Transmission on Wrangler JK
| Code | Meaning |
|---|---|
| 2 | L / Low Line, Wrangler Sport or base model |
| 3 | M / Medium, Wrangler Unlimited or Sport |
| 5 | P / Premium, Wrangler Sahara or Wrangler Sahara Unlimited |
| 6 | S / Sport, Wrangler Rubicon or Wrangler Rubicon Unlimited |
| B | 4-speed automatic VLP, sales code DGV |
| C | 6-speed manual, sales code DEH |
| E | 5-speed automatic, sales code DGQ |
VIN Position 7: Body Style on Wrangler JK
| Code | Body style |
|---|---|
| 4 | Short open body, JK 72 |
| 9 | Extended open body, JK 74 |
| B | Short open body, JK 72 |
| C | Extended open body, JK 74 |
| D | Short open body, JK 72 |
| H | Extended open body, JK 74 |
VIN Position 8: Engine Code on Wrangler JK
| Code | Engine |
|---|---|
| 5 | 2.8 L 16V 4-cylinder turbo diesel ENS |
| 9 | 2.8 L 16V 4-cylinder turbo diesel Next Generation, ENS |
| 1 | 3.8 L V6 gasoline ETG |
| G | 3.6 L V6 gasoline ERB |
VIN Positions 9 to 17: Check Digit, Model Year, Plant and Serial Number
| VIN position | Meaning | Code / value | Explanation |
|---|---|---|---|
| 9 | Check digit | 0–9 or X | VIN control character |
| 10 | Model year | B | 2011 |
| 10 | Model year | C | 2012 |
| 10 | Model year | D | 2013 |
| 10 | Model year | E | 2014 |
| 10 | Model year | F | 2015 |
| 10 | Model year | G | 2016 |
| 10 | Model year | H | 2017 |
| 10 | Model year | J | 2018 |
| 11 | Assembly plant | L | Toledo South Assembly, Ohio |
| 12–17 | Serial number | six-digit number | Vehicle build sequence |
VIN Codes Jeep Grand Cherokee WK2: Model Years 2011–2018
The following tables help decode the Vehicle Identification Number for the Jeep Grand Cherokee WK2 from model years 2011 to 2018. Engine code, trim level, left-hand-drive or right-hand-drive configuration and model year are particularly important for correct part fitment.
VIN Positions 1 to 4: Country, Manufacturer, Vehicle Type and GVWR on Grand Cherokee WK2
| VIN position | Meaning | Code | Explanation |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Country | 1 | USA |
| 2 | Manufacturer | J | Jeep |
| 2 | Manufacturer | C | Chrysler Group LLC |
| 3 | Vehicle type | 4 | MPV / multi-purpose vehicle |
| 4 | GVWR | A / G / N / V | 1815–2267 kg / 4001–5000 lb |
| 4 | GVWR | B / H / P / X | 2268–2721 kg / 5001–6000 lb |
| 4 | GVWR | C / J / R / Y | 2722–3175 kg / 6001–7000 lb |
| 4 | GVWR | D / K / S / Z | 3176–3628 kg / 7001–8000 lb |
| 4 | GVWR | E / L / T / 1 | 3629–4082 kg / 8001–9000 lb |
VIN Positions 5 to 7: Vehicle Line, Drive Type and Trim on Grand Cherokee WK2
On the Grand Cherokee WK2, the exact meaning of individual VIN positions can vary by model year. From model years 2012 to 2014 in particular, vehicle line, drive type and trim level are encoded in more detail.
| VIN position | Code |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 5 | S | Grand Cherokee 2WD |
| 5 | R | Grand Cherokee 4WD |
| 5 | 2 | Grand Cherokee right-hand drive 4WD |
| 5 | J | Jeep, used as brand position on certain WK2 model years |
| 6 | 4 | Grand Cherokee Laredo |
| 6 | 5 | Grand Cherokee Limited |
| 6 | 6 | Grand Cherokee Overland |
| 6 | 7 | Grand Cherokee SRT8 / SRT |
| 6 | E | 2WD, used as drive-type code on certain WK2 model years |
| 6 | F | 4WD, used as drive-type code on certain WK2 model years |
| 7 | G | Sport Utility 4-door |
| 7 | A / E | Grand Cherokee Laredo, left-hand drive or right-hand drive depending on model year |
| 7 | B / F | Grand Cherokee Limited, left-hand drive or right-hand drive depending on model year |
| 7 | C / G | Grand Cherokee Overland, left-hand drive or right-hand drive depending on model year |
| 7 | D / H | Grand Cherokee SRT8 / SRT, left-hand drive or right-hand drive depending on model year |
| 7 | K | Grand Cherokee Summit right-hand drive, model year 2014 |
VIN Position 8: Engine Code on Grand Cherokee WK2
| Code | Engine |
|---|---|
| G | 3.6 L V6 gasoline ERB |
| M | 3.0 L V6 turbo diesel EXF |
| J | 6.4 L V8 gasoline ESG |
| T | 5.7 L V8 gasoline EZH |
| P | 4.7 L V8 gasoline MPI, depending on model year |
| 2 | 5.7 L V8 gasoline MDS, depending on model year |
VIN Positions 9 to 17: Check Digit, Model Year, Plant and Serial Number on Grand Cherokee WK2
| VIN position | Meaning | Code / value | Explanation |
|---|---|---|---|
| 9 | Check digit | 0–9 or X | VIN control character |
| 10 | Model year | B | 2011 |
| 10 | Model year | C | 2012 |
| 10 | Model year | D | 2013 |
| 10 | Model year | E | 2014 |
| 10 | Model year | F | 2015 |
| 10 | Model year | G | 2016 |
| 10 | Model year | H | 2017 |
| 10 | Model year | J | 2018 |
| 11 | Assembly plant | C | Jefferson North Assembly / Jefferson Assembly |
| 12–17 | Serial number | six-digit number | Vehicle build sequence |
Note on Grand Cherokee WK2 Model Years 2012–2014
On the Grand Cherokee WK2, individual VIN positions can be structured slightly differently depending on the model year. Model years 2012, 2013 and 2014 in particular may provide more detailed information about Laredo, Limited, Overland, SRT8, Summit, LHD and RHD versions.
For spare part identification, the model name “Grand Cherokee WK2” alone is not always enough. The exact model year according to the VIN, the engine code and the trim / configuration should also be checked.
Frequently Asked Questions About Jeep VINs 2011–2018
Which VIN position shows the Jeep model year?
The model year is shown by the 10th character of the 17-character Jeep Vehicle Identification Number. For this guide, the codes are B = 2011, C = 2012, D = 2013, E = 2014, F = 2015, G = 2016, H = 2017 and J = 2018.
Why is the model year more important than the first registration date?
Many Jeep vehicles are registered later than their actual technical model year. For spare parts and accessories, the model year according to the VIN is often more important than the first registration date.
Which Jeep models are covered in this VIN guide?
This guide mainly covers the Jeep Wrangler JK, Jeep Wrangler JK Unlimited and Jeep Grand Cherokee WK2 for model years 2011 to 2018.
Can I identify my Jeep engine from the VIN?
Yes. The 8th VIN character provides the engine code. On the Wrangler JK, relevant engines include 2.8 CRD, 3.8 V6 and 3.6 V6. On the Grand Cherokee WK2, important engines include 3.0 V6 diesel, 3.6 V6, 5.7 V8 and 6.4 V8.
